Skip to content

chore: Move mypy to uv #14086

chore: Move mypy to uv

chore: Move mypy to uv #14086

Triggered via pull request May 28, 2026 12:39
Status Success
Total duration 1m 44s
Artifacts 18
Matrix: GraphQL
All GraphQL tests passed
4s
All GraphQL tests passed
Fit to window
Zoom out
Zoom in

Annotations

17 warnings
GraphQL (3.12, ubuntu-22.04)
Failed to save: Unable to reserve cache with key setup-uv-2-x86_64-unknown-linux-gnu-ubuntu-22.04-unknown-pruned-922fd4deb2c6dbb0d941a73a8ede5cbf54276d561d8018cec7e1faae7a752812, another job may be creating this cache.
GraphQL (3.12, ubuntu-22.04)
Patch coverage defaulted to 100% because no changed files matched coverage data. Unmatched diff files: .github/workflows/ci.yml, AGENTS.md, pyproject.toml, scripts/populate_tox/package_dependencies.jsonl, scripts/populate_tox/releases.jsonl, scripts/populate_tox/tox.jinja, scripts/split_tox_gh_actions/templates/test_group.jinja, tox.ini, uv.lock Sample coverage paths: sentry_sdk/__init__.py, sentry_sdk/_batcher.py, sentry_sdk/_compat.py This usually indicates a path format mismatch between your coverage tool and the repository.
GraphQL (3.11, ubuntu-22.04)
Failed to save: Unable to reserve cache with key setup-uv-2-x86_64-unknown-linux-gnu-ubuntu-22.04-unknown-pruned-922fd4deb2c6dbb0d941a73a8ede5cbf54276d561d8018cec7e1faae7a752812, another job may be creating this cache.
GraphQL (3.11, ubuntu-22.04)
Patch coverage defaulted to 100% because no changed files matched coverage data. Unmatched diff files: .github/workflows/ci.yml, AGENTS.md, pyproject.toml, scripts/populate_tox/package_dependencies.jsonl, scripts/populate_tox/releases.jsonl, scripts/populate_tox/tox.jinja, scripts/split_tox_gh_actions/templates/test_group.jinja, tox.ini, uv.lock Sample coverage paths: sentry_sdk/__init__.py, sentry_sdk/_batcher.py, sentry_sdk/_compat.py This usually indicates a path format mismatch between your coverage tool and the repository.
GraphQL (3.9, ubuntu-22.04)
Failed to save: Unable to reserve cache with key setup-uv-2-x86_64-unknown-linux-gnu-ubuntu-22.04-unknown-pruned-922fd4deb2c6dbb0d941a73a8ede5cbf54276d561d8018cec7e1faae7a752812, another job may be creating this cache.
GraphQL (3.9, ubuntu-22.04)
Patch coverage defaulted to 100% because no changed files matched coverage data. Unmatched diff files: .github/workflows/ci.yml, AGENTS.md, pyproject.toml, scripts/populate_tox/package_dependencies.jsonl, scripts/populate_tox/releases.jsonl, scripts/populate_tox/tox.jinja, scripts/split_tox_gh_actions/templates/test_group.jinja, tox.ini, uv.lock Sample coverage paths: sentry_sdk/__init__.py, sentry_sdk/_batcher.py, sentry_sdk/_compat.py This usually indicates a path format mismatch between your coverage tool and the repository.
GraphQL (3.8, ubuntu-22.04)
Failed to save: Unable to reserve cache with key setup-uv-2-x86_64-unknown-linux-gnu-ubuntu-22.04-unknown-pruned-922fd4deb2c6dbb0d941a73a8ede5cbf54276d561d8018cec7e1faae7a752812, another job may be creating this cache.
GraphQL (3.8, ubuntu-22.04)
Patch coverage defaulted to 100% because no changed files matched coverage data. Unmatched diff files: .github/workflows/ci.yml, AGENTS.md, pyproject.toml, scripts/populate_tox/package_dependencies.jsonl, scripts/populate_tox/releases.jsonl, scripts/populate_tox/tox.jinja, scripts/split_tox_gh_actions/templates/test_group.jinja, tox.ini, uv.lock Sample coverage paths: sentry_sdk/__init__.py, sentry_sdk/_batcher.py, sentry_sdk/_compat.py This usually indicates a path format mismatch between your coverage tool and the repository.
GraphQL (3.14, ubuntu-22.04)
Failed to save: Unable to reserve cache with key setup-uv-2-x86_64-unknown-linux-gnu-ubuntu-22.04-unknown-pruned-922fd4deb2c6dbb0d941a73a8ede5cbf54276d561d8018cec7e1faae7a752812, another job may be creating this cache.
GraphQL (3.14, ubuntu-22.04)
Patch coverage defaulted to 100% because no changed files matched coverage data. Unmatched diff files: .github/workflows/ci.yml, AGENTS.md, pyproject.toml, scripts/populate_tox/package_dependencies.jsonl, scripts/populate_tox/releases.jsonl, scripts/populate_tox/tox.jinja, scripts/split_tox_gh_actions/templates/test_group.jinja, tox.ini, uv.lock Sample coverage paths: sentry_sdk/__init__.py, sentry_sdk/_batcher.py, sentry_sdk/_compat.py This usually indicates a path format mismatch between your coverage tool and the repository.
GraphQL (3.10, ubuntu-22.04)
Failed to save: Unable to reserve cache with key setup-uv-2-x86_64-unknown-linux-gnu-ubuntu-22.04-unknown-pruned-922fd4deb2c6dbb0d941a73a8ede5cbf54276d561d8018cec7e1faae7a752812, another job may be creating this cache.
GraphQL (3.10, ubuntu-22.04)
Patch coverage defaulted to 100% because no changed files matched coverage data. Unmatched diff files: .github/workflows/ci.yml, AGENTS.md, pyproject.toml, scripts/populate_tox/package_dependencies.jsonl, scripts/populate_tox/releases.jsonl, scripts/populate_tox/tox.jinja, scripts/split_tox_gh_actions/templates/test_group.jinja, tox.ini, uv.lock Sample coverage paths: sentry_sdk/__init__.py, sentry_sdk/_batcher.py, sentry_sdk/_compat.py This usually indicates a path format mismatch between your coverage tool and the repository.
GraphQL (3.13, ubuntu-22.04)
Failed to save: Unable to reserve cache with key setup-uv-2-x86_64-unknown-linux-gnu-ubuntu-22.04-unknown-pruned-922fd4deb2c6dbb0d941a73a8ede5cbf54276d561d8018cec7e1faae7a752812, another job may be creating this cache.
GraphQL (3.13, ubuntu-22.04)
Patch coverage defaulted to 100% because no changed files matched coverage data. Unmatched diff files: .github/workflows/ci.yml, AGENTS.md, pyproject.toml, scripts/populate_tox/package_dependencies.jsonl, scripts/populate_tox/releases.jsonl, scripts/populate_tox/tox.jinja, scripts/split_tox_gh_actions/templates/test_group.jinja, tox.ini, uv.lock Sample coverage paths: sentry_sdk/__init__.py, sentry_sdk/_batcher.py, sentry_sdk/_compat.py This usually indicates a path format mismatch between your coverage tool and the repository.
GraphQL (3.6, ubuntu-22.04)
Patch coverage defaulted to 100% because no changed files matched coverage data. Unmatched diff files: .github/workflows/ci.yml, AGENTS.md, pyproject.toml, scripts/populate_tox/package_dependencies.jsonl, scripts/populate_tox/releases.jsonl, scripts/populate_tox/tox.jinja, scripts/split_tox_gh_actions/templates/test_group.jinja, tox.ini, uv.lock Sample coverage paths: sentry_sdk/__init__.py, sentry_sdk/_batcher.py, sentry_sdk/_compat.py This usually indicates a path format mismatch between your coverage tool and the repository.
GraphQL (3.14t, ubuntu-22.04)
Failed to save: Unable to reserve cache with key setup-uv-2-x86_64-unknown-linux-gnu-ubuntu-22.04-unknown-pruned-922fd4deb2c6dbb0d941a73a8ede5cbf54276d561d8018cec7e1faae7a752812, another job may be creating this cache.
GraphQL (3.14t, ubuntu-22.04)
Patch coverage defaulted to 100% because no changed files matched coverage data. Unmatched diff files: .github/workflows/ci.yml, AGENTS.md, pyproject.toml, scripts/populate_tox/package_dependencies.jsonl, scripts/populate_tox/releases.jsonl, scripts/populate_tox/tox.jinja, scripts/split_tox_gh_actions/templates/test_group.jinja, tox.ini, uv.lock Sample coverage paths: sentry_sdk/__init__.py, sentry_sdk/_batcher.py, sentry_sdk/_compat.py This usually indicates a path format mismatch between your coverage tool and the repository.

Artifacts

Produced during runtime
Name Size Digest
codecov-coverage-results-neel-uv-mypy-test-graphql
122 KB
sha256:7a4902c595dca989603682ef254d075dd9f851c2f0e4f119a44f0116792b0bd0
codecov-coverage-results-neel-uv-mypy-test-graphql
122 KB
sha256:c3bd8b59c5b94112439b4f5c4118e206d9969bfa5231302fb6746e1cd61be85b
codecov-coverage-results-neel-uv-mypy-test-graphql
123 KB
sha256:d093c2302260333cec178ab30c62c915261ab1186a237575dbd6c8847010e1ab
codecov-coverage-results-neel-uv-mypy-test-graphql
121 KB
sha256:177a72615ded243b661e78a5f92d4882992ac5f430eec642e4a3903ca35d6f47
codecov-coverage-results-neel-uv-mypy-test-graphql
121 KB
sha256:9da2a2d67effa8255e0b654a6fd6f57b51358b06c15757f760a06c4329fdfa7a
codecov-coverage-results-neel-uv-mypy-test-graphql
122 KB
sha256:1bb37b101fb52be4b8ddf584380f20b18d6fc673608d762aa65cf77a6da14e42
codecov-coverage-results-neel-uv-mypy-test-graphql
122 KB
sha256:6501a2e2f1e5802b113e18e2bd64598f2e9ca27fcc4e400a54a23eacc71cdf6b
codecov-coverage-results-neel-uv-mypy-test-graphql
123 KB
sha256:130b739949ab8d54836ecb76a9a8bd323822e92c48819222aea38c66ff48adf7
codecov-coverage-results-neel-uv-mypy-test-graphql
123 KB
sha256:b253f290d4555091d6f686daa5a7fa2717eaee69c004c787f8023b4ed57a9b53
codecov-test-results-neel-uv-mypy-test-graphql
238 Bytes
sha256:bf42e8e3d5d719644cff0b8eb31f9a42266a81e401ab651139da55cd1fadd9b0
codecov-test-results-neel-uv-mypy-test-graphql
231 Bytes
sha256:a8ed65badc2e5ef6b6f4b901bcd4110af30ac66bfea6fc3d3fc36b9aa350d0b5
codecov-test-results-neel-uv-mypy-test-graphql
232 Bytes
sha256:f822088ddb32c4b8b0de20c6b4180b6f4bf3057891ef532b8da48ed1c8afc733
codecov-test-results-neel-uv-mypy-test-graphql
232 Bytes
sha256:be94f5caade21533e465850b4a75b073f44197e13d3d56e45bf5bc669866f1ea
codecov-test-results-neel-uv-mypy-test-graphql
238 Bytes
sha256:7fc5dcc5451a2aa21518c3a87de63a35fcb651767aa16ffa504ca51c6cea0839
codecov-test-results-neel-uv-mypy-test-graphql
230 Bytes
sha256:2f4f0846b0d0c50b97bd8e34c4d3d00d3840181d38da1ddaf8546de78d0e3915
codecov-test-results-neel-uv-mypy-test-graphql
230 Bytes
sha256:27fac2acc29f2d2f5feab4fbed99cc3bf8e116c2dba7b1cab0e5d607a79c2c44
codecov-test-results-neel-uv-mypy-test-graphql
237 Bytes
sha256:6b32ad5249c73c46e905bd500bc1a310eafc40de2f6795a204a727478441b7ec
codecov-test-results-neel-uv-mypy-test-graphql
230 Bytes
sha256:ec489bed6b6b662f6072f9716e314cfd59f4326781d838bcc1405ccd02e89a52